Jan. 4, 2003 Ensley Bottoms Shelby Co. TN Crossing the bridge this afternoon while returning from a productive CBC in Arkansas that produced a female Richardson's Merlin, a light morph Western Red-tailed Hawk, 4 species of warblers, Blue-headed Vireo, 4 species of geese, lots of Greater and Lesser Yellowlegs (90), 2-Long-billed Dowitchers, 2-Short-eared Owls, and last but not least a mind blowing WHITE-RUMPED SANDPIPER, I decided to go by Ensley Bottoms in the rain. Ensley paid off again, when after over 45 minutes of scanning through the hordes of Scaup, I came across a female BLACK SCOTER. It was like looking for a needle in a haystack if you took your eyes off her. Even at the distance and with the rain, I got ID shots of this rare scoter for TN. There were quite a few Greater Scaup in the ever changing numbers but less than a couple of weeks ago. I usually am able to get one Black on my year list in TN but this is only my second for Shelby, Co. in 20 years. I'll share shots of the scaup flock plus the scoter to those interested....
